Construction

FOS&S sensing solutions are extensively used in civil engineering, mainly for Structural Health Monitoring of bridges, dams, tunnels, buildings, historical monuments, etc.  By monitoring parameters such as strain, load, displacement and temperature, FOS&S solutions increase the safety of civil-engineering infrastructures and enable timely preventative maintenance, reduced routine maintenance costs and reduced remedial repairs.  All this translates into lower total cost of ownership due to extended service.

Structural Health Monitoring (SHM) of the Olympic Stadium (Athens)
The main objective of the project is the Structural Health Monitoring (SHM) of the steel roof structure of the Velodrome and the Olympic Stadium in Athens, by means of a fibre optic sensing network.
